Eisenhower had to start their season on the road on Friday, and it wasn't the start they were hoping for. They took a 37-30 hit to the loss column at the hands of the Battle Ground Tigers.
When it comes to explaining why Eisenhower lost, don't look at Moses Spurrier. Despite the final result, he threw for 184 yards and two touchdowns on only 17 passes, and also rushed for 54 yards. The dominant performance gave him a new career- in rushing yards. Eisenhower also got help from Larry Jolliffe, who showed off his sure hands for 109 receiving yards.
Both squads will have to hit the road in their upcoming games. Eisenhower will get a bit of extra time to process the loss as their next game is a ways off. They'll take on Wenatchee at 7:00 p.m. on September 20th. As for Battle Ground, they will face off against Mountain View at 7:00 p.m. on Friday.
